Dr. Aman Rastogi is a pioneering colorectal surgeon whose research focuses on advancing minimally invasive surgical techniques for complex rectal cancers. His most cited work, a 2024 propensity-matched analysis comparing robotic versus laparoscopic beyond total mesorectal excision for advanced rectal cancer, has already garnered 9 citations, underscoring its timely impact. Dr. Rastogi’s major contribution lies in rigorously evaluating the role of robotic surgery in challenging oncologic resections, demonstrating potential short-term benefits such as reduced hospital stays, faster bowel recovery, and fewer complications. By addressing a critical gap in the literature—the utility of robotic platforms for beyond-TME procedures—he provides evidence that can guide surgical decision-making and improve patient outcomes.
